  • Muriam Haleh Davis – The Absent Preface: Algerian Readings of Frantz Fanon after Independence

    Humanities 1, Room 210 1156 high st, Santa cruz, CA, United States

    In 1959, Ferhat Abbas, the President of the GPRA (Provisional Government of the Algerian Republic), refused Frantz Fanon’s request to write a preface for L’An V de la révolution algérienne. This never-written preface is emblematic of a larger silence regarding the lively Algerian debates on Fanon’s writings after independence. By foregrounding North African interpretations of Fanon’s […]
